Solution Overview
Problem
Existing information processing systems fail to effectively recommend nursing care items to caregivers and individuals in need, as they do not consider the similarity in relationships and life environments between users, leading to irrelevant advertisements.
Innovation Solution
An information processor that includes a processor and memory, holding information on relationships, item purchase histories, and life environments of caregivers and individuals, which judges similarities to provide targeted advertisements based on these factors.

Data Source
AI summary
Provided an information processor capable of proposing more useful items to a user. An information processor includes: a processor; and a memory. The memory holds: first information on a relationship between a first assistant and a first person to be assisted who is assisted by the first assistant; second information on a relationship between a second assistant and a second person to be assisted who is assisted by the second assistant; third information on an item purchase history of the first assistant and/or the first person to be assisted; and fourth information on an item purchase history of the second assistant and/or the second person to be assisted. The processor judges a similarity between the first information and the second information, and provides an advertisement based on the fourth information to the first assistant and/or the first person to be assisted if judging that a similarity is observed between the first information and the second information.
